Interview with Julie Bindel on Feminism for women

About this episode

In this episode, Matthew talks to the journalist, writer, broadcaster and researcher - Julie Bindel. Julie writes regularly for The Guardian newspaper, the New Statesman, The Sunday Telegraph and Standpoint magazines, and appears regularly on the BBC and Sky News. Julie's focus in on issues such as rape, domestic violence, sexually motivated murder, prostitution and stalking. In this episode, Julie talks about two of her publications in the form of 'The pimping of prostitution' and her upcoming book 'Feminism for women'.
